titleOfInvention | Prepreg and laminate using the same |
abstract | A prepreg having a low dielectric loss and excellent fluidity such as wiring embedding and a laminate obtained by using the prepreg and excellent curing characteristics such as crack resistance. A prepreg obtained by impregnating reinforcing fibers with a curable resin composition containing a conjugated diene-based linear polymer, a conjugated diene-based branched polymer, and a radical generator, and using the prepreg The resulting laminate. Preferably, the conjugated diene-based linear polymer is polybutadiene and / or polyisoprene, and the conjugated diene-based branched polymer is a copolymer of a conjugated diene monomer and an aromatic vinyl monomer. And having three or more branches via a polyfunctional coupling agent. [Selection figure] None |
